Recommended Action:

Recommended Action

Approval of the purchase authorization with Ring Power Corporation to purchase a Caterpillar 800KW generator per the pricing of the Florida Sheriff’s Association (FSA) cooperative contract.

 

                     This generator will create a shelter location at Building A on the Lealman Campus during a possible natural disaster for County citizens.

                     Funding for this purchase is derived from the Emergency Management Department budget; the intent is to install the generator as soon as possible in the event of hurricane activity.

                     Pricing is per FSA cooperative contract providing government organizations in Florida savings through economy of scale.

 

Contract No.190-0340-PB(AJM) in the amount of $307,547.00. Authorize the Chairman to sign and the Clerk of the Circuit Court to attest.

Summary:

Summary

This purchase authorization is for a Caterpillar 800KW Generator to be utilized at the Lealman Campus.  This unit will power Building A, the building, that has been identified as a shelter location for citizens during a possible disaster threat.  The desire is to have this generator in place as soon as possible in the event of hurricane activity. 

Body

 

Background Information:

This is a direct purchase in the attempt to expedite the process and have the unit operational for the citizens in the event of a hurricane this season. County Job Order Contracts will be utilized to expedite the development of the infrastructure and the enclosure at Building A on the Lealman Campus for this unit.

 

Fiscal Impact:

Total expenditure not to exceed:                                                               $307,547.00

 

Funding is derived from the Emergency Management operating budget.
